Output e48359894f4cf8167b1a074c14240d115e3cd43834ceab8ab35d14e6b35c5942:1

value
24690784754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93b8df79a14234c8720b9ec8b68e4dddc6c7ae34 OP_EQUALVERIFY OP_CHECKSIG
address
PmPrwUhzV1hN6keemuzeVHc7SEfpisdQQb
transaction
e48359894f4cf8167b1a074c14240d115e3cd43834ceab8ab35d14e6b35c5942